Note: this recipe calls for pre-cooked chicken breast. You can either pre-cook the chicken before making this fennel salad, seasoning to your personal taste. Alternatively, you can purchase frozen, pre-cooked chicken breast and add that to the salad. This recipe does not the time to prep the chicken since it will be different based on personal preference.
In a mixing bowl combine the oil, lemon juice, mustard, and garlic. Stir until well combined.
Add the fennel, red onion, and parsley and stir to coat with the dressing.
Divide the arugula between plates and top with the fennel mixture and any excess dressing.
Add the cooked chicken and sprinkle with the chopped pistachios.
Enjoy your low-carb fennel salad with chicken and arugula!
